Jamie at Fuel Moto had the fix. Just like our computers, once in a while when you load a program, it works, but the program didn't load all that it was supposed too, so you have to reload..... Same simple fix on the Power Commander.Plug Power Commander into laptop,Open Power Commander program,turn bike key to on, click on get map, click on "Tools", then at bottom of list click on "Enviroment Options", and at the bottom of that list click "Reset Power Commander" some wordy words pop up about erasing or deleting map file, 'delete' this is what you need to do, then click "OK".... reload map that Jamie emailed you, or the Power Commander map from their web site. Reset throttle position. Fixed.No more stalling.
I had the right idea by loading a new map yesterday,however, I now knowyou should always "reset power commander" if you are going to load amap,and notrely on thenew map writing over the old map.Or in this case, that the pre map unit accepted the map upload in its entirety .
To bypass the Power Commander you can go through the process of deleting the Power Commander map in the "enviroment options tab", then start the bike...it runs just like Harley had it,... lean and no power.
